Ouachita Parish, Louisiana LAND For Sale - 10.03 Acres
Ouachita Parish, Louisiana LAND For Sale - 10.03 Acres
Just Reduced! Located on Mathis Road, just south of LA Hwy 34 in Ouachita Parish. Property is near the intersection of Mathis Road and Mt. Vernon Church Road. The property has 100 yds of blacktop road frontage. Good area with all or most utilities. The timber on this tract is a 4 year old pine plantation. Excellent access, with the ease of being only 15 minutes of West Monroe, LA. There is adjoining property that could also be purchased.

Property type:
LAND
Parcel Size:
10.03 Acres
Price:
$53,350 or approximately $5,319 per acre
MLS or other ID:
22073H035
